Journal of Leukocyte Biology | 1989
Senwa Unten; Hiroshi Sakagami; Kunio Konno
Antitumor substances (Fractions VI and VII) prepared from the NaOH extract of pine cone significantly stimulated the iodination (incorporation of radioactive iodine into an acid‐insoluble fraction) of human peripheral blood adherent mononuclear cells, polymorphonuclear cells (PMN), and human promyelocytic leukemic HL‐60 cells. In contrast, these fractions did not significantly increase the iodination of nonadherent mononuclear cells, red blood cells, other human leukemic cell lines (U‐937, THP‐1, K‐562), human diploid fibroblast (UT20Lu), or mouse cell lines (L‐929, J774.1). iodination of HL‐60 cells, which were induced to differentiate by treatment with either retinoic acid or tumor necrosis factor, were stimulated less than untreated cells. The stimulation of iodination of both PMN and HL‐60 cells required the continuous presence of these fractions and was almost completely abolished by the presence of myeloperoxidase inhibitors. The stimulation activity of these fractions was generally higher than that of various other immunopotentiators. Possible mechanisms of extract stimulation of myeloperoxidase‐containing cell iodination are discussed.
Letters in Applied Microbiology | 1991
A. Mukoyama; H. Ushijima; Senwa Unten; S. Nishimura; Yoshihara M; Hiroshi Sakagami
An NH4OH extract from seed shell of Pinus koraiensis Sieb. et Zucc. inhibited infections of rotavirus and enterovirus in cultured rhesus monkey kidney MA 104 cells. Antiviral activity of the extract was attributable to interference with virus adsorption, rather than to inhibition of virus replication after adsorption.
Letters in Applied Microbiology | 1991
Senwa Unten; H. Ushijima; H. Shimizu; H. Tsuchie; T. Kitamura; N. Moritome; Hiroshi Sakagami
A sodium hydroxide extract from cacao husk inhibited the cytopathic effect of human immunodeficiency virus type 1 (HIV‐1) against HTLV‐1‐transformed T‐cell lines MT‐2 and MT‐4. It also inhibited syncytium formation between HIV‐infected and uninfected lymphoblastoid T‐cell line, MOLT‐4. The anti‐HIV activity was concentrated by membrane filter fractionation to a fraction with molecular weight of 100–300 KDa. Anti‐HIV activity of the extract was attributable to interference with the virus adsorption, rather than to inhibition of the virus replication after adsorption.
Mechanisms of Development | 1983
Senwa Unten; Hiroshi Sakagami; Kunio Konno
Mouse myeloid leukemia (M1) cells were induced to differentiate in vitro by treatment with dexamethasone. After 8 h of treatment, induction of phagocytic and lysozymic activities and depression of DNA synthesis started at the same time and proceeded irreversibly. DNA synthesis in the nuclear system reflected primarily DNA replication rather than repair and this activity declined during M1 cell differentiation.
